Linux下MatlabCompilerRuntime的安装和使用

1、下载MCR2、安装MCR3、使用MCR4、总结在Linux系统中,需要从MathWorks官网上下载相应版本的MCR。不同版本的MCR只能运行相应版本的MATLAB程序。

在Linux系统中,如果需要运行基于MATLAB编写的程序,就需要先安装MATLAB Compiler Runtime(MCR)。本文将介绍如何在Linux系统上安装和使用MCR。

一、下载MCR

首先,需要从MathWorks官网上下载相应版本的MCR。下载地址为:-runtime.html

选择对应版本后,点击“Download”进行下载。注意:不同版本的MCR只能运行相应版本的MATLAB程序。

二、安装MCR

1. 解压缩文件

将下载得到的文件解压缩到任意目录下:

“`

$ tar -xzvf MCR_R2017b_glnxa64_installer.zip

2. 安装

进入解压后得到的目录,并执行以下命令:

$ sudo ./install -mode silent -agreeToLicense yes

其中,“-mode silent”表示以静默模式进行安装,“-agreeToLicense yes”表示同意许可协议。

Linux下MatlabCompilerRuntime的安装和使用

等待安装完成即可。

三、使用MCR

要想在Linux系统中运行基于MATLAB编写的程序,需要设置环境变量LD_LIBRARY_PATH。具体方法如下:

1. 打开终端,并输入以下命令:

$ export LD_LIBRARY_PATH=/usr/local/MATLAB/MATLAB_Runtime/v94/runtime/glnxa64:/usr/local/MATLAB/MATLAB_Runtime/v94/bin/glnxa64:/usr/local/MATLAB/MATLAB_Runtime/v94/sys/os/glnxa64:/usr/local/MATLAB/MATLAB_Runtime/v94/extern/bin/glnxa64

其中,“/usr/local/MATLAB”为MCR的安装路径,可能因版本而异。

2. 运行MATLAB程序

设置好环境变量后,即可运行基于MATLAB编写的程序。例如:

$ ./test

其中“test”为一个MATLAB程序的可执行文件。

四、总结

本文介绍了在Linux系统中安装和使用MCR的方法,希望对大家有所帮助。如果您在使用过程中遇到问题,请参考官方文档或留言咨询。

最后,提醒大家注意版本兼容性,并保证环境变量设置正确。